5th Singapore Dialogue : At the 5th Singapore Dialogue on Sustainable World Resources (SDSWR), Senator Loren Legarda and fellow panelists for the session, “How ASEAN Governments are Shifting to Green Growth,” were in agreement that coal is yesterday’s fuel. Legarda said coal will go into its own obsolescence as it becomes more expensive and with renewables becoming cheaper. With Legarda are (from left to right) Daniel Mallo, Societe Generale Head of Natural Resources and Infrastructure for Asia Pacific, Professor Simon Tay, Chairman of the Singapore Institute of International Affairs (SIIA), and Goh Swee Chen, Chairman of Shell Companies in Singapore.
